Maybe you could focus your paper on the large number of variables involved in climate study?

You've got your sunspot minimums cooling the world, your C02 warming the world, your soot cooling the world, your Atlantic currents spreading the heat from the equator to the poles, your increased water vapor from heating creating clouds that cool the world, etc. etc.

The really nice thing about libraries is that they often come equipped with librarians. Most people don't know this, but librarians will do a ton of research for you -- weeding out the questionable and recommending the good sources.
